C1FlexGrid 模仿 Microsoft Excel 自动计算功能
来源:互联网 发布:阿里云 安装包 编辑:程序博客网 时间:2024/06/07 13:47
本示例展示了如何使用 C1FlexGrid 实现 Microsoft Excel 自动计算功能。
测试环境 Visual Studio 2010、.NET 4.0、Studio for WinForms 2012V3
本示例中的核心代码是 CalcEngine 类中的转换器-Parser 和 计算器-Evaluator。Parser 用于转化 String 到 数值类型。Evaluator 用于计算 Parser 的转化结果。
var ce = new CalcEngine();var expression = ce.Parse("1+2+3");var value = expression.Evaluate();
或者,可以通过 CalcEngine 类下的 Evaluate 方法直接进行计算。
var ce = new CalcEngine();var value = ce.Evaluate("1+2+3");
运行截图:
详细可以下载 Demo 查看:示例下载
- C1FlexGrid 模仿 Microsoft Excel 自动计算功能
- C1FlexGrid中实现类似Excel单元格计算的功能
- Excel的自动计算提示功能
- 模仿Excel的窗口冻结功能
- 模仿IE的自动完成功能,支持FireFox
- 模仿IE自动完成功能,读取输入框存取记录
- 模仿百度搜索的自动提示功能 高大上
- excel自定公式的自动计算
- HOWTO:在 Visual Basic 中自动运行 Microsoft Excel
- 模仿Google搜索功能
- js模仿微信摇一摇功能
- 模仿微信摇一摇功能
- 模仿IE自动完成功能,读取输入框存取记录 (强)
- C1FlexGrid手记
- 使用DataGridView模拟Excel的计算汇总功能
- Excel cell 内公式不自动计算解决方法
- jxls--使用模版导出excel,单元格无法自动计算问题解决
- excel工作量清单计算开始、结束时间,自动跳过节假日
- windows xp + cocos2d-x搭建
- do{ ... } while(0)
- JAVASE----05----多态
- yii framework Url: hide index.php
- CString与const char*转换
- C1FlexGrid 模仿 Microsoft Excel 自动计算功能
- 导入android工程@Override报错
- 关于汉字编码问题
- Opencv知识积累
- 阅读pdf时让单面连续阅读
- MP3播放器
- c++例题 构造函数(二)
- Maven3.0.5运行junit,slf4j报错
- 测试 , renameTo 需要全路径,若有同名 则覆盖